Best Quotes From For The Love Of The Game

“For the Love of the Game” is a sports movie that explores the passion and dedication of a veteran baseball pitcher named Billy Chapel, played by Kevin Costner. Released in 1999, the film takes us on a journey through Chapel’s final game as he reflects on his career and contemplates his future. Along the way, there are many memorable quotes that capture the essence of the game and the emotions of the characters.

One of the most famous quotes from the movie is when Billy Chapel says, “Clear the mechanism”. This phrase represents his ability to focus and block out all distractions while on the mound. It encapsulates the mental toughness required to succeed in a high-pressure situation and has become a mantra for athletes and fans alike.
